Required Qualifications

  • 10+ years of field sales experience, preferably in data or cloud-related technology (experience)
  • 5+ years' industry-focused experience in expanding and generating new business within prospective, large FSI & Banking customers (experience)
  • Extensive Banking industry expertise (experience)
  • Proven ability to independently manage, develop, and close new client relationships (experience)
  • Experience hitting quota of $1M+ of ARR per year (experience)
  • A track record of success in driving consistent activity, pipeline development, and quota achievement (experience)
  • Experience determining customer requirements and presenting appropriate solutions (experience)
  • Pro-active, independent thinker with high energy and a positive attitude (experience)
  • Excellent verbal and written communication, presentation, and relationship management skills (experience)
  • Ability to thrive in fast-paced startup environment (experience)
  • Executive-level relationship management (experience)
  • Ability to understand the "bigger picture" and the business drivers around IT (experience)
  • Experience implementing MEDDPICC (Bonus) (experience)
  • Experience selling software or cloud-based applications to the Enterprise (Bonus) (experience)

Responsibilities

  • Achieve sales quotas for allocated, prospective accounts on a quarterly and annual basis
  • Develop a sales strategy in the allocated territory with a target prospect list and a regional sales plan
  • Develop marketing plans with the marketing team to drive revenue growth
  • Serve as a trusted advisor to customers by understanding their existing and future IT roadmap to drive Snowflake solution adoption
  • Prospect qualification and development of new sales opportunities and ongoing revenue streams
  • Arrange and conduct initial Executive and CxO discussions and positioning meetings
  • Manage the sales process and opportunity closure
  • Conduct ongoing account management to ensure customer satisfaction and drive additional revenue streams
  • Utilize a solution-based approach to selling
  • Manage complex sales processes
  • Effectively present and listen to clients to understand their needs
  • Maintain excellent organization and contact management
